NameDescriptionTypeAdditional information
AccountManagementOnline

OnlineTariffOption

None.

Address

AddressBindingModel

None.

BillConsumptionIsEstimated

boolean

Required

CurrentCostEstimated

decimal number

Data type: Currency

Range: inclusive between 0 and 9000

CurrentPayMethod

PayMethod

Required

CurrentUsageEstimated

integer

Range: inclusive between 0 and 200000

CustomerId

integer

None.

EmailAddress

string

Data type: EmailAddress

IsHappyToBeAutoSwitched

boolean

None.

Postcode

string

Required

Data type: PostalCode

ReferrerBranchCode

string

Required

Max length: 10

SwitchOwnerReference

string

Max length: 50

SwitchType

SwitchType

Required

TariffId

integer

Required

TariffValidToDate

date

None.

UtilityPeriod

UtilityPeriod

Required